E
Ecological Park
Address
Downtown Road, London SE16 6
Postcode District
SE16
City
London
County
London
Country
England
Show map
Calculate route
Download AutoMapa navigation
Nearest POIs
Downtown Road, London SE16 6
Hollywood Bowl
Teredo Street, London SE16 7
Docklands Trading Post
564 Rotherhithe Street, London SE16 5GX
Hollywood Diner
Teredo Street, London SE16 7
Aardvark
351 Rotherhithe Street, London SE16 5LJ
Blacksmiths Arms
Rotherhithe Street, London
King & Queen Wharf Porters Lodge
Rotherhithe Street, London
Surrey Docks Dental Surgery
Downtown Road, London SE16 6
The Ship & Whale
Gulliver Street, London SE16 7LT
Currys.Digital
Redriff Road, London SE16 7PH
Bacon's College
Timber Pond Road, London SE16 6AG
Nearest POIs from category Park and Recreation Area
Downtown Road, London SE16 6
Sir John McDougal Gardens
Westferry Road, London E14 8JT
Friendly Gardens
Friendly Street, London SE8 4DT
Pepys Park
Grove Street, London SE8 3LT
Folkestone Park
Rolt Street, London SE8 5NL
Peckham Rye Common
Peckham Rye, London
Grove Hall Park
Jebb Street, London E3 2TL
Peckham Rye Common
Peckham Rye, London
Weavers Fields
Viaduct Place, London E2 0
Chiltern Green
Chiltern Road, London E3 4BX
Meath Gardens
Smart Street, London E2 0SB